The whole street about 350 meters is covered under roof and it’s called arcade shopping street.
Very close from Bandobashi subway station.
Very lively shopping area where many food stands, restaurants, groceries and other shops selling goods during daytimes.
Good to walk around and buy nibbles here or there. Well recommended place for raining day activities.

Unless you are staying nearby, it is unlikely you will make special effort to come here, as there are many such pedestrian shopping streets all over Japan.
This covered pedestrian shopping street is about 300m, with eateries, drugs stores, shops selling seafood, local produce, snacks, etc. There is a 100 yen store too. When I was there at 5:45pm, some shops were already closed. More shops started to close by 7pm. Recommend to visit this street early.
